It would be great if someone can put some light on dose linearity for Hydrocortisone acetate. The information available in the literature is very confusing with few suggesting it's linear between the dose up to 40mg and then few say nonlinear due to absorption and protein binding and show less than dose-proportional increase in AUC.


In case we have to plan this study for the EU/UK do we need to do a study on higher and lower strength both?
